Cryogenic milling refers to a technique whereby the subject material is cooled, typically using liquid nitrogen, prior to milling. in the case of processing plastics and resins, for example, the purpose is to ensure that the material becomes (or remains) embrittled, notwithstanding the introduction of high levels of energy from the milling.

Mechanical alloying is a solid-state powder processing technique that involves repeated cold welding, fracturing, and rewelding of powder particles in a high-energy ball mill. originally developed about 50 years ago to produce oxide-dispersion-strengthened ni- and fe-based superalloys for aerospace and high temperature applications, it is now recognized as an important technique to synthesize.
